This study aims to compare the effect of unilateral and bilateral plyometric training in combination with resisted sprint on stride length and stride frequency of adolescent boy's sprinters. Forty-five moderately trained subjects, aged 13 to 15 years studying in different schools from Idukki and Kottaym districts, of Kerala state, India were selected as subjects. The selected subjects were divided into three groups, namely Unilateral Plyometric training in Combination with Resisted Sprinting (UPTCRS) Group I (n = 15), Bilateral Plyometric Training in Combination with Resisted Sprinting (BPTCRS) Group II (n = 15) and (CG) control Group III (n=15). Both the groups performed maximal effort of plyometric leg exercises and resisted sprinting for 3 days a week for 12 weeks. Group I performed all the exercises with full repetition of each limb subsequently change to other side of the limb, the left side followed by right limb. Group II performed all the exercises with both limb simultaneously. The data were analysed by using SPSS version 20, paired 't' test for each group, and ANCOVA were used to find out the effect between the groups. The paired mean differences were determined using Scheff's post hoc test whenever the adjusted post-test 'F' ratio values were found to be significant. Results of the study shows that unilateral and bilateral plyometric training in combination with resisted sprinting were significantly improved on stride length and stride frequency.

Increasing road accidents are a source of concern for everyone these days, and the road and safety department of the Indian government, as well as state governments, are working hard to control them using various means. Braking system must assure to the customer that this is the safest equipment provided to the vehicle for avoiding accidents. Brakes must fulfil and capable to meet all the required parameters of modern vehicles such as speed power and comfort. The friction pad and disk cause the wheels to slow down during braking. The present work is aimed to study the behaviour of the disc brake with various sizes of perforation on the disc brake rotor by means of various parameters. The parameters considered in the work are diameter of holes 8mm, 10mm, 12mm; circular patterns holes 32, 26, 20 on the disc brake and the distance between the holes 8mm, 9mm and 10mm. Materials consider during the analysis are AISI 1020, AISI 1040, AISI 1113, AISI 1213. From the findings it is observed that AISI 1020 material has performed better than other materials in terms of their strength and attained lower deformation in comparison with other materials

PCR is a molecular biology technique that amplifies a single or few copies of DNA, generating thousands to millions of copies. It is widely used in medical and biological research labs for various applications. It consists of three major steps which includes denaturation, annealing, and extension. PCR is useful in investigating and diagnosing various diseases and detects human genes, as well as bacterial and viral genes. It requires only a tiny amount of original DNA, making it valuable in forensic science. PCR identifies genes implicated in cancer development and has also benefited many molecular cloning techniques. This review provides a solid foundation for understanding the basics of PCR, its history, applications, and impact on various fields.

This paper examines the fundamental transformation of India's market structure from traditional monopolistic competition to platform-based economies, focusing on the period 2019-2024. The research analyzes how digital platforms have reshaped competitive dynamics in the Indian market through network effects, economies of scale, and data-driven strategies. Drawing on comprehensive market data and case studies of major platforms like Zomato, Flipkart, and Paytm, we investigate the drivers and implications of this transition. Our findings indicate that India's digital economy, projected to reach USD 1 trillion by 2028, is characterized by increasing platform dominance and "winner-takes-all" dynamics. The study reveals how regulatory frameworks, particularly through the Competition Commission of India's interventions, are evolving to address the unique challenges posed by platform economies. This research contributes to the growing literature on digital market dynamics in emerging economies and provides insights for policymakers navigating the complexities of platform-based competition.

: The process of Ayurveda drug discovery has received a big boost from the use of high-end computers and machine learning algorithms. There are many new drugs introduced into the market each year, making it difficult for Ayurveda doctors to keep up with the latest advancements. In this proposed work we introduce an end-to-end system that is able to go through the literature of newly discovered drugs and store the features in a database. Then, it is able to accept the symptoms of a patient from a physician/Ayurveda doctor and recommend appropriate Ayurveda drugs, which may be prescribed to the patient, subject to the discretion of the physician/ Ayurveda doctor. We'll use a variety of supervised machine learning methods before deciding which one is best for the model. Datasets collected from www.kaggle.com and www.githib.com and supervised learning algorithms applied to process the datasets and drug recommendation is done. There are many research works on this topic where they have built models and shown results, around 80 to 85% accuracy generated using R language, Python language and data science tools. But all these works are just models, cannot be used as application useful in real time. In our project work we build an application with model that can recommend the suitable Ayurveda drug based on the parameters like symptoms, disease, drug rating etc. It focuses on various feature selection techniques and prediction models to enhance disease diagnosis, improve patient survival rates, and recommend the best lifestyle practices to follow. Proposed system is a real time medical system useful for hospitals and doctors and built using Microsoft tools such as Visual Studio tool and SQL Server tool.
